Tennessine (Ts)

Tennessine — element 117
Ts
[294] · Halogen · period 7, group 17

Tennessine was the last of the seventh period to be filled in, and making it required 22 milligrams of berkelium-249 grown over two years in Oak Ridge's reactor, flown to Russia, and bombarded before it decayed — the target had a shelf life of months. Six atoms were produced in the first campaign. It is filed as a halogen because it sits in group 17, but calculations suggest it would not behave like one: relativistic effects should make the −1 state unfavourable, so tennessine may be closer to a metal than to iodine.

Melting point, boiling point, density and electronegativity are omitted: no measurement is possible. Named for the state of Tennessee, the second US state to have an element named after it after California. The mass given is the mass number of tennessine-294, the longest-lived at roughly 50 milliseconds.

Several physical properties are not listed for tennessine because no bulk sample has ever existed. Only a handful of atoms have been produced, often with half-lives measured in seconds, so published melting points and densities for elements in this range are calculations rather than measurements. They are omitted rather than presented as observed values.

Group 17

Elements in the same group share their outer electron count, which is why they behave similarly in reactions. Tennessine sits in group 17 with fluorine, chlorine, bromine, iodine, astatine.
